This is the AWS Firewall Manager API Reference. This guide is for developers who need detailed information about the AWS Firewall Manager API actions, data types, and errors. For detailed information about AWS Firewall Manager features, see the AWS Firewall Manager Developer Guide.
Details of the resource that is not protected by the policy.
Describes the compliance status for the account. An account is considered noncompliant if it includes resources that are not protected by the specified policy or that don't comply with the policy.
A client for the FMS API.
An AWS Firewall Manager policy.
Describes the noncompliant resources in a member account for a specific AWS Firewall Manager policy. A maximum of 100 entries are displayed. If more than 100 resources are noncompliant,
Indicates whether the account is compliant with the specified policy. An account is considered noncompliant if it includes resources that are not protected by the policy, for AWS WAF and Shield Advanced policies, or that are noncompliant with the policy, for security group policies.
Details of the AWS Firewall Manager policy.
The resource tags that AWS Firewall Manager uses to determine if a particular resource should be included or excluded from the AWS Firewall Manager policy. Tags enable you to categorize your AWS resources in different ways, for example, by purpose, owner, or environment. Each tag consists of a key and an optional value. Firewall Manager combines the tags with "AND" so that, if you add more than one tag to a policy scope, a resource must have all the specified tags to be included or excluded. For more information, see Working with Tag Editor.
Details about the security service that is being used to protect the resources.
A collection of key:value pairs associated with an AWS resource. The key:value pair can be anything you define. Typically, the tag key represents a category (such as "environment") and the tag value represents a specific value within that category (such as "test," "development," or "production"). You can add up to 50 tags to each AWS resource.
Errors returned by AssociateAdminAccount
Errors returned by DeleteNotificationChannel
Errors returned by DeletePolicy
Errors returned by DisassociateAdminAccount
Errors returned by GetAdminAccount
Errors returned by GetComplianceDetail
Errors returned by GetNotificationChannel
Errors returned by GetPolicy
Errors returned by GetProtectionStatus
Errors returned by ListComplianceStatus
Errors returned by ListMemberAccounts
Errors returned by ListPolicies
Errors returned by ListTagsForResource
Errors returned by PutNotificationChannel
Errors returned by PutPolicy
Errors returned by TagResource
Errors returned by UntagResource
Trait representing the capabilities of the FMS API. FMS clients implement this trait.